Log in to followAN ACT relating to publication.
Amend KRS 424.145 to remove the population restriction and make the alternative publication procedure available to all local governments as defined; stipulate that the local government must submit the advertisement to the newspaper in a timely manner for publication within the prescribed limits; make technical corrections.

Plain-language summary
This bill would change Kentucky law to allow all local governments to use an alternative method for publishing official public notices in newspapers, removing a rule that previously limited this option based on population size. It also adds a requirement that local governments submit their notices to newspapers in a timely way to meet legal deadlines. Who it may affect: residents of smaller or rural communities, and local government agencies across Kentucky.
